Coinbase logosu

Kripto parçalama nedir ve nasıl çalışır?

What is crypto sharding and how does it work?
  • Parçalama, blockchain ağlarının ölçeklenebilirliğini artırmayı hedefleyen bir tekniktir ve bunu, onları parçalar olarak bilinen daha küçük parçalara böler.

  • Her parça, kendi işlemlerini ve akıllı sözleşmelerini işler, bu da potansiyel olarak işlem hızını artırabilir ve bireysel düğümlerdeki yükü azaltabilir.

  • Parçalama, faydalar sunabilirken, aynı zamanda güvenlik ve karmaşıklıkla ilgili zorlukları da beraberinde getirir.

Sharding Nedir?

Sharding, geleneksel veritabanı yönetim sistemlerinden kaynaklanan bir kavramdır. Blockchain teknolojisi bağlamında, sharding, daha büyük bir blockchain ağını daha küçük, daha yönetilebilir parçalara, shard olarak bilinenlere bölmeyi ifade eder. Her shard, kendi benzersiz işlem veri alt kümesine sahip olur ve kendi işlemlerini ve akıllı sözleşmelerini işler. Bu iş bölümü, her shard'ın diğerlerinden bağımsız olarak işlemleri işleyebilmesi nedeniyle, artan işlem hızı ve ölçeklenebilirlik sağlayabilir.

Sharding Nasıl Çalışır?

Tipik bir blockchain ağında, her düğüm tüm işlemleri işlemekten sorumludur, bu da ağ büyüdükçe işlem hızlarının yavaşlamasına yol açabilir. Sharding, düğümleri bireysel parçalara atayarak bu sorunu çözmeye çalışır. Her parça kendi işlemlerini ve akıllı sözleşmelerini işler, bu da potansiyel olarak bireysel düğümlerdeki yükü azaltabilir ve işlemlerin işlenme hızını artırabilir. İşlemlerin paralel işlenmesi, blockchain ağının etkili bir şekilde ölçeklendirilmesine olanak sağlar, potansiyel olarak ağ büyüdükçe saniyede daha fazla işlem gerçekleştirebilir.

Pratikte Sharding: Ethereum

Ethereum, iyi bilinen bir blockchain ağı, şu anda ölçeklenebilirlik çabalarının bir parçası olarak sharding'i uygulamaktadır. Ethereum ağı, her biri işlemleri işleyen bir dizi düğümü ele alan birden çok parçaya (shard) bölünmüştür. Her shard'daki doğrulayıcılar, işlemleri doğrular ve shard'ın durumunu korur. Bu yaklaşım, tüm düğümlerin her işlemde yer aldığı mevcut işlem işleme formatından farklıdır. Sharding, Ethereum'un işlem kapasitesini artırmayı ve potansiyel olarak gas ücretlerini azaltmayı hedeflemekte, böylece ağı kullanıcıları için daha verimli ve maliyet etkin hale getirmektedir.

Sharding'in Zorlukları

Sharding, ölçeklenebilirlik ve işlem hızı açısından avantajlar sunsa da, belirli zorlukları da beraberinde getirir. Ana endişelerden biri güvenliktir. Her shard kendi işlemlerini gerçekleştirdiğinden, bir shard'ın saldırıya uğraması ve bilgi kaybına yol açması riski vardır. Ayrıca, sharding'in karmaşıklığı nedeniyle, onu uygulamak dikkatli planlama ve uygulama gerektirir. Birden çok shard'ı içeren bir işlem olan cross-shard işlemleri, özellikle ele alınması karmaşık olabilir.

Sharding'in Geleceği

Zorluklarına rağmen, sharding birçok blockchain ağı tarafından karşılaşılan ölçeklenebilirlik sorunlarına potansiyel bir çözüm olarak görülüyor. Daha fazla blockchain projesi sharding'i uyguladıkça, blockchain alanında işlem hızında ve ölçeklenebilirlikte iyileştirmeler görebiliriz. Sharding'in, ölçeklenebilirlik sorununa yönelik birçok potansiyel çözümden sadece biri olduğunu ve blockchain teknolojisinin geleceğinin muhtemelen farklı stratejilerin bir kombinasyonunu içereceğini unutmak önemlidir.

Sadece birkaç dakikada Bitcoin satın alın

Kişilerin ve işletmelerin kripto para satın almak, satmak ve yönetmek için en çok güvendikleri yer biziz.